Clydach Community Gardens is a not-for-profit environmental organisation improving community wellbeing and resilience through horticulture and nature based activities, and supporting the development of new and existing green spaces in Clydach, Swansea 

polytunnel people edit.png

Clydach Community Gardens launched in Spring 2019, transforming a disused piece of public land into an educational green space for learning about food, climate and the environment. Over the years we have developed a core group of nature-loving volunteers, built links with local schools and groups, and created a beautiful safe haven for all members of the community. 

We run weekly sessions for our core volunteer base as well as additional activities and events for the wider community. We teach organic and regenerative practices, predominantly focusing on fruit, vegetable, and flower production. Through our activities we deliver informal education and local capacity building, as well as providing a welcoming atmosphere where attendees can learn new skills, spend time in nature, and make new connections within their community.

What we offer: 

​

  • volunteering opportunities 

  • social and therapeutic horticulture

  • workshops and training 

  • green social prescribing  

  • school visits and educational sessions 

  • corporate volunteering and team building activities 

  • events and fundraisers 

​​

We also offer bespoke sessions and activities tailored to the needs of individuals and groups, as well as delivering sessions off site in either a classroom setting or in your green space. 

As a not-for-profit CIC, we’re able to deliver sessions and projects through funding opportunities, donations and in-kind support. We have strong relationships with local and national stakeholders of which we are keen to expand.
